When it comes to describing the power level of a source, there are a variety of synonyms that can be used. "Intensity", "magnitude", and "potency" are all words that can be used to convey the strength of a source. Other synonyms include "force", "energy", and "amplitude". These words are particularly useful when describing things like sound waves or electromagnetic radiation, where the power level of the source is important for understanding its effects on the environment. In general, the key to choosing the right synonym for "power level of source" is to consider the context and intended meaning of the phrase.
